"The National Academy of Sciences as incorporated by an act of Congress on March 3, 1863, to advise the government on scientific matters, but did not have its own permanent headquarters until this building designed by Goodhue was erected in 1922-24. Bertram Grosvenor Goodhue's design is a free adaptation of the neo-classical style. The facade is one of extreme simplicity and refinement enlivened by bronze panels by Lee Lawrie. On both exterior and interior the building exhibits a unity of architecture and decorative arts. Sculpture by Lee Lawrie, paintings by Albert Hester, and decorations on the dome by Hildreth Meiere are outstanding features." - National Register Nomination

The building is used for lectures, symposia, exhibitions, and concerts, in addition to annual meetings of the National Academy of Science, National Academy of Engineering, and Institute of Medicine. Approximately 150 staff members work at the National Academy of Science Building.

In 2012 a major two year renovation of the building was completed restoring the historic features and bringing the aging infrastructure of the building up to date.
